Facial Aesthetics

Facial aesthetics encompasses surgical and non-surgical applications aimed at achieving a more balanced, youthful, and dynamic appearance while preserving the individual’s natural facial features. Since the face is at the center of facial expressions, emotions, and first impressions, it is of great importance that the procedures performed are extremely precise, planned, and personalized. The primary goal in facial aesthetics is to achieve natural results that are in harmony with the face and free from exaggeration.

Every individual’s facial anatomy, skin structure, bone proportions, and aging process are different. For this reason, facial aesthetic applications should be carried out not with standard methods, but with a detailed evaluation and personal planning. Modern plastic surgery approaches are based on preserving the functional integrity and natural expression of the face, rather than just improving its appearance.


Procedures Applied Within the Scope of Facial Aesthetics

Facial aesthetics has a wide field of application. Among the most frequently preferred procedures are rhinoplasty (nose surgery), facelift, blepharoplasty (eyelid surgery), brow lift, and cheek and jaw contour adjustments. In addition, non-surgical applications such as fillers and botox are also an important part of facial aesthetics.

While surgical procedures are generally preferred for individuals with a significant change in facial features or sagging problems, non-surgical methods are mostly applied for fine lines, volume loss, and wrinkles caused by facial expressions. Which method is suitable is determined in line with the expectations and facial structure of the person.


Who is Suitable for Facial Aesthetics?

Facial aesthetics is suitable for individuals who are not satisfied with their facial appearance, want to reduce the signs of aging, or aim to correct congenital asymmetries and disproportions. In addition to physical suitability, it is of great importance that the individual has realistic expectations and evaluates the process consciously.

During a detailed examination, the most accurate approach is determined by evaluating facial proportions, skin quality, and expression structure. The goal is to achieve natural and permanent results that make the person feel better about themselves.


Process After Facial Aesthetics

The recovery process after facial aesthetics varies according to the procedure performed. While slight swelling and bruising may be seen in the first few days after surgical procedures, the individual can generally return to daily life in a short time following non-surgical applications. Compliance with the doctor’s recommendations during the healing process is of critical importance for the permanence and success of the results.
